Output 7ec6131c7eceaa16b753f3a8d778cbeff10c202b1e53313a9a81cf4453b0c77a:5

value
131717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ecab9d3669378003e2aa2193400eafb9bdb9fde4 OP_EQUAL
address
3PGQymoSBJ9a2pxJgtjNxxinShbwRuySXJ
transaction
7ec6131c7eceaa16b753f3a8d778cbeff10c202b1e53313a9a81cf4453b0c77a
confirmations
175568
spent
true